What Chanote (NS4J) means
A Chanote, formally Nor Sor 4 Jor (NS4J), is a full ownership title deed issued by the Thai Land Department. It confirms ownership rights and shows precisely surveyed boundaries.
Because the plot is measured with accurate GPS/survey methods, Chanote land is typically easier to transfer, finance and develop than land with weaker documents.
Why Chanote is considered the safest
Chanote provides the clearest evidence of ownership and plot limits. That reduces disputes about where the land starts and ends, and makes Land Office transfers more straightforward.
Banks and serious buyers usually prefer Chanote. Weaker titles can still be valuable, but they often need upgrades, extra surveys or higher legal risk buffers.
How to verify a Chanote
Ask for clear scans of every page, then confirm details at the local Land Office: title number, owner, area, location and any registrations against the land.
Cross-check the physical land against the title map. If something feels off — different owners, odd boundaries, missing pages — pause the deal.

What the Red Garuda means
Many Chanote documents show the Garuda emblem associated with official Thai government paperwork. Buyers often call strong Chanote papers “Red Garuda” titles in everyday conversation.
The emblem itself is not a substitute for verification. Always confirm authenticity and current ownership through official channels, not by appearance alone.
Comparison with other titles
Chanote: strongest common freehold title, precise survey, preferred for purchase and lending.
Nor Sor 3 Gor: usable and often upgradeable, but may need more checks than Chanote.
Nor Sor 3 / weaker documents: higher uncertainty on boundaries and upgrade path — only proceed with specialist advice and thorough due diligence.
